6. DEF Company manufactures and sells a single product that sells for $450 per unit; varialble costs are $270. Annual fixed costs are $800,000. The products current break-even point in dollars is $2,000,000 and sales are expected to be $4,000,000. (5 Points) The current margin of safety in dollars is: (5 Points) The current margin of safety percentage is: 7. XYZ Company manufactures and sells a single product that sells for $400 per unit; variable costs are $200. Annual fixed costs are S500,000. The products contribution margin is $200 with a contribution margin ratio of 50% and the target net income is $1,000,000. (5 Points) Compute the dollar sales at target net income: (5 Points) Compute the unit sales at target net income
